When I first found this book in a stack at the public library, I was about 4 and the year was 1959. I remember being thrilled by Marjorie Flack's beautiful illustrations and inspired by the story told by author DuBose Heyward. In fact I became so fixated on this book that my mother finally had to special order a copy from the local bookstore in order to persuade me to return the library's copy. Highly recommended for its gentle but spirited message and lovely presentation.
